Anda bertanya: Apa itu basis data Android?

SQLite adalah database SQL opensource yang menyimpan data ke file teks di perangkat. Android hadir dengan implementasi database SQLite bawaan. SQLite mendukung semua fitur database relasional. Untuk mengakses database ini, Anda tidak perlu membuat koneksi apa pun seperti JDBC, ODBC, dll.

Basis data mana yang terbaik untuk Android?

Sebagian besar pengembang seluler mungkin akrab dengan SQLite. Sudah ada sejak tahun 2000, dan bisa dibilang mesin database relasional yang paling banyak digunakan di dunia. SQLite memiliki sejumlah manfaat yang kita semua akui, salah satunya adalah dukungan aslinya di Android.

Apakah kelas dasar database Android?

SQLiteDatabase: SQLiteDatabase adalah kelas dasar dan menyediakan metode untuk membuka, membuat kueri, memperbarui, dan menutup database. ... ContentValues ​​dapat digunakan untuk penyisipan dan pembaruan entri database. Kueri dapat dibuat dengan menggunakan metode rawQuery() dan query() atau kelas SQLiteQueryBuilder.

Apakah database diperlukan untuk aplikasi Android?

Basis data untuk ponsel harus:

Tidak ada persyaratan server. Berupa library tanpa atau minimal ketergantungan (embeddable) sehingga dapat digunakan pada saat dibutuhkan. Cepat dan aman. Mudah ditangani melalui kode, dan opsi untuk menjadikannya pribadi atau dibagikan dengan aplikasi lain.

Apa kegunaan database SQLite di Android?

SQLite Database adalah database open-source yang disediakan di Android yang digunakan untuk menyimpan data di dalam perangkat pengguna dalam bentuk file Teks. Kami dapat melakukan banyak operasi pada data ini seperti menambahkan data baru, memperbarui, membaca, dan menghapus data ini.

Bisakah saya menggunakan SQL di Android?

Halaman ini mengasumsikan bahwa Anda sudah familiar dengan database SQL secara umum dan membantu Anda memulai dengan SQLite database di Android. API yang Anda perlukan untuk menggunakan database di Android tersedia di file android. basis data. … Anda perlu menggunakan banyak kode boilerplate untuk mengonversi antara kueri SQL dan objek data.

Apa itu API di Android?

API = Application Programming Interface

API adalah seperangkat instruksi dan standar pemrograman untuk mengakses alat web atau database. Sebuah perusahaan perangkat lunak merilis API-nya ke publik sehingga pengembang perangkat lunak lain dapat merancang produk yang didukung oleh layanannya. API biasanya dikemas dalam SDK.

Apa perbedaan antara Android API dan Google API?

Google API mencakup Google Maps dan perpustakaan khusus Google lainnya. Yang Android hanya menyertakan pustaka Android inti. Adapun yang mana yang harus dipilih, saya akan menggunakan Android API sampai Anda menemukan bahwa Anda memerlukan Google API; seperti saat Anda membutuhkan fungsionalitas Google Maps.

Apa dua jenis utas utama di Android?

Android memiliki empat tipe dasar utas. Anda akan melihat dokumentasi lain berbicara lebih banyak lagi, tetapi kami akan fokus pada Thread , Handler , AsyncTask , dan sesuatu yang disebut HandlerThread . Anda mungkin pernah mendengar HandlerThread baru saja disebut "Handler/Looper combo".

Apakah aplikasi seluler menggunakan SQL?

Basis Data Aplikasi Seluler Populer

MySQL: Sebuah open source, multi-threaded, dan database SQL yang mudah digunakan. PostgreSQL: Basis data relasional berbasis objek open source yang kuat dan sangat dapat disesuaikan. Redis: Sumber terbuka, pemeliharaan rendah, penyimpanan kunci/nilai yang digunakan untuk penyimpanan data dalam aplikasi seluler.

Basis data mana yang terbaik untuk Python?

SQLite kemungkinan merupakan database yang paling jelas untuk terhubung dengan aplikasi Python karena Anda tidak perlu menginstal modul database Python SQL eksternal. Tentu saja, instalasi Python Anda berisi pustaka Python SQL bernama SQLite3 yang dapat Anda manfaatkan untuk terhubung dan berinteraksi dengan database SQLite.

Bagaimana cara menghapus basis data Android saya?

Anda dapat menghapus database secara manual dengan Hapus data . pengaturanaplikasikelola Aplikasi'pilih aplikasi Anda'hapus data.

Bagaimana kita bisa membuat database di Android?

Gunakan metode updateHandler() sebagai berikut:

  1. updateHandler boolean publik(int ID, nama String) {
  2. SQLiteDatabase db = ini. getWritableDatabase();
  3. ContentValues ​​args = new ContentValues();
  4. argumen. put(COLUMN_ID, ID);
  5. argumen. put(COLUMN_NAME, nama);
  6. kembali db. perbarui(TABLE_NAME, argumen, COLUMN_ID + “=" + ID, null) > 0;
  7. }

Apa kursor di Android?

Kursor adalah apa yang berisi kumpulan hasil kueri yang dibuat terhadap database di Android. Kelas Cursor memiliki API yang memungkinkan aplikasi membaca (dengan cara yang aman untuk mengetik) kolom yang dikembalikan dari kueri serta mengulangi baris kumpulan hasil.

Suka postingan ini? Silakan bagikan ke teman Anda:
OS Hari Ini